Output ce5c53bf2ddcb321bceb2f722d4697eb656b8976106d76a4e95dd8bc28ea5dea:1

value
66977
script pubkey
OP_0 OP_PUSHBYTES_20 e18bafca34a0dc3e64d9b8613f3578e738f837ab
address
bc1qux96lj355rwruexehpsn7dtcuuu0sdatpradee
transaction
ce5c53bf2ddcb321bceb2f722d4697eb656b8976106d76a4e95dd8bc28ea5dea
confirmations
317268
spent
true